A groundbreaking ceremony was held at the site of the Atlee Library on Wednesday, May 15, and construction is underway.
The library, which will be located in Rutland at the corner of U.S. Rt. 301 and Rutlandshire Drive, is expected to open by the summer of 2020. It will replace the current storefront library in the Atlee Square Shopping Center.
The new Atlee Library represents a partnership between the Pamunkey Regional Library Board and the County. Speaking at the May 15 ceremony were Angela Kelly-Wiecek and W. Canova Peterson of the Board of Supervisors and Joe O’Connor, Chairman of the Pamunkey Regional Library Board.
